6335 is an odd number because it cannot be divided by 2
6335 is a positive number.
6335 is a 4 digit no
10 Multiples of 6335 are = 6335,12670,19005,25340,31675,38010,44345,50680,57015,63350,
Prime Factors of 6335 = 5, 7,181
Factors of 6335 are = 1, 5, 7, 35, 181, 905, 1267, 6335
